Chapter 138

THE NIGHT BEFOREThe camp was quieter than usual. There were no victory songs, no loud boasts from the warriors, and no sounds of sharpening blades. Most of that had been done days ago. Now, there was just the crackle of small fires and the low hum of families saying things they should have said years ago.

Esmeralda sat on a fallen log near the edge of the clearing. She looked at her hands. They were calloused now, stained with the dirt of the training field. She felt older than she was.
